A preview back in 2020: TikTok vs. Trump

During trump presidency in 2020, Trump signed an executive order targeting TikTok over concerns that the Chinese control the app, developed by ByteDance, posed a national security risk. His administration alleged that the Chinese government could access the personal data of American users through the app  an accusation TikTok repeatedly denied howsoever.

Trump pushed for a price of TikTok’s in U.S. operations to a bad company, and briefly, a deal involving Walmart seemed to be in the works. While that sale never materialized, Trump’s aggressive stance forced ByteDance into months of legal and political limbo. The issue faded somewhat after Joe Biden took office, in his time.

Since President Biden signed a law in April 2024 forcing TikTok’s parent company ByteDance to divest or face a U.S. ban, the process remains tied up in legal challenges ever snice

TikTok, which boasts over 160 million users in the United States, continues to argue that it operates independently of the Chinese government and poses no security threat. The company filed a lawsuit against the U.S. government, calling the forced sale unconstitutional.
